Currently Uni-fab, up here in Cartersville (well, technically, however, in reality, it is between Acworth and Emerson). I'm getting my powder coating done through them as well.

I'd been buying from Steel Materials up here in Cartersville, but they recently changed ownership, and a few of the guys that worked there (the ones that pretty well ran the place, and were the reason I went there), left and started Uni-fab, so I followed them over to the new place. As an added advantage, I've seen a 15% reduction in aluminum prices, which were already decent.

The one downside is they don't keep much aluminum on the shelf, and it has to be ordered, but generally, you can order it over the phone, and it is ready to be picked up in 2 days.

There is a Metals supermarket in Marietta. I've not priced them recently, and never for aluminum, but their steel prices have always been significantly higher than what I was paying up here, so the only times I've bought from them is when I've needed something NOW, and my usual place wasn't open, or didn't have it in stock.
